In a swift anti-corruption operation, Odisha Vigilance apprehended a peon from the Special Treasury Office in Jeypore, Koraput district, for demanding and accepting a bribe from the widow of a deceased government employee.
The accused, Harischandra Mohapatra, was caught red-handed while taking Rs 47,000 as the second and final instalment of an overall bribe demand of Rs 87,000.
The incident stems from Mohapatra’s exploitation of the complainant, who sought the release of her late husband’s arrears pension amounting to Rs 3,48,000. Mohapatra had demanded 25% of the pension amount as a bribe, having already received Rs 40,000 as the first instalment a few days prior.
